Preparation of covalent-bound iodofullerene through selective opening of fullerene epoxide to form halohydrin fullerene derivatives

摘要
The epoxy moiety in a fullerene mixed peroxide can be opened regioselectively by various Lewis acids to form halohydrin fullerene derivatives. The first iodofullerene was obtained by treating the fullerene epoxide with triphenylphosphine and iodine. A single-crystal structure of the chlorohydrin derivative supports the results.
